Pam-

In your selection of new SMOC's for KidSat, please consider the York County School System and the Newport News City School System. Both are located in Southeastern Virginia and have expressed keen interest in the KidSat program, and they are in a position to provide the necessary resources. One is a rural system with a diverse student population and the second is an urban system with a diverse student population.

LaRC would support both initiatives if they are selected. Details will follow in the near term.
